LAUNCH OF ARMED FORCES DAY 2010
A
rmed Forces Day to honour Service personnel, past, present
and future will be held on Saturday 26 Jun 10. Cardiff has been chosen to host the 2010 national event, which will be complemented by over 100 community-led events in towns and cities across the UK.
FREE Adventures for young people this Summer
T
he Royal British Legion offer Poppy Adventure Breaks during the school holidays taking groups
of 12-17 year olds away for seven nights. If you can say ‘yes’ to just one of the eligibility criteria your child qualifies. A one parent household? A parent on ops? A parent disabled? No holiday in 3 years? Household income less than £25,000? The RBL also offer Family Holiday breaks.
